it seems to be wrinkling right after the cutter unit maybe even in the cutter unit. I have tried the tech bulletin about the joint that did not work. It only happens on 36".I totally disassembled the inner transport and also the rollers under the developer cannot seem to figure it out.Any suggestions

Depending on where you are located. You may want to turn off or on the humidity switch located on the lower right rear of the 7000. Seems to have corrected our wrinkling problems.

I am actually waaaaaay up here in the mountains and that definitley crossed my mind. I believe that the cutter is not going into home position properly. I am waiting for the special jig so i can adjust that. I will keep you all posted.
